Consistent — The saved data cannot violate the integrity of the database.
In databases that possess durability, data is saved once a transaction is completed, even if a power outage or system failure dofs. Define ACID at usainfo.space What do the letters in ACID stand for? # 1. # 2.
I seeking dick
The transaction has Consistency to ensure the audit trail is saved. All validation rules must be accid to ensure consistency. Samuel explained it very well. This allows readers to operate without wtand locks, i. Consistency This ensures that you guarantee that all data will be consistent. Consider two transactions: T1 transfers 10 from A to B. By interleaving the transactions, the actual order of actions might be: T1 subtracts 10 from A.
We would not want to girls nude in granite city illinois the amount removed from A before we are sure it has been transferred into B. When databases possess these components, they are said to be ACID-compliant. No transaction will be affected by any other transaction.
Going back to the example, when user A's transaction requests data that user B is modifying, the database provides A with the version of that data that existed when user B started his transaction. Combined, there are four actions: T1 subtracts 10 from A.
What’s an example of acid properties?
Another example would be with integrity constraints, which would not allow us to delete a row in one table whose primary key is referred to by at least one foreign key in other tables. According to the ACID definition, a database is consistent Single fit and competent and only if it contains the of successful transactions.
Assume that a transaction attempts to subtract 10 voes A without altering B. Accurate, Consistent, Isolated, Dependable.
A guarantee of atomicity prevents updates to the database occurring only partially, which can cause greater problems than rejecting the whole series outright. The user assumes understandably that the changes persist. Thus, consistency means that only data which follows those rules is permitted to be written to the database. In these examples, the database table has two columns, A and Hairy brunette shows bush.
Then, unless and until both transactions have happened and the amount has been transferred to B, the transfer has not, to the effects of the database, occurred. At one moment in time, it Ladies seeking sex Ouray Colorado not yet happened, and at the next it has already occurred in whole or nothing happened if the transaction roes cancelled in progress.
For a database, isolation refers to the ability to concurrently process multiple transactions in a way that one does not affect another. An example whwt an atomic transaction is a monetary transfer from bank A to B. May Learn doex and when to remove this template message The following examples further illustrate the ACID properties.
In a typical system, the problem would Horny Thousand oaks women resolved by reverting to the last known good state, canceling the failed transaction T1, and restarting the interrupted transaction T2 from the good state. Main article: Distributed transaction Guaranteeing ACID properties in a distributed transaction across a distributed databasewhere no single node is aciid for all data affecting a transaction, presents additional complications.
What does ACID stand for? How would ACID help in this situation?
Quiz: what does the acronym acid mean?
Looking to Brazil new might help to look at ACID database properties and its concepts using an example. The entire transaction must be cancelled and the affected rows rolled back to their pre-transaction state. As a consequence, the transaction cannot be observed to be in progress by another database acir.
Don't keep it to yourself! Possible Answers. First it removes 10 from A, then it adds 10 to B. On the other hand, following a successful transaction, new data will be added to the database and the resulting state will be consistent with existing rules. By the time T1 fails, T2 has already modified A; it cannot be restored to the value it stanf before T1 without leaving an invalid database.
Just for completeness: although the german database professor Theo Härder had database transactions in mind when he coined. 25 definitions of ACID.
Acid compliance: what it means and why you should care
Again, doee what happens if T1 fails while modifying B in Step 4. ACID abbreviation. The two-phase commit protocol not to be confused with two-phase locking provides Hot ladies seeking nsa Belo Horizonte for distributed transactions to ensure that each participant in the transaction agrees on whether the transaction should be committed or not. The lock must always be acquired before processing data, including data that is read but not modified.
What is acid compliance?
T1 acis 10 to B. For example, if user A Beautiful older ladies seeking casual dating Missoula Montana running a transaction that has to read a row of data that user B wants to modify, user B must wait until user A's transaction completes. If this journal entry fails, then wnat entire transfer is aborted and s restored to original balances. The ACID properties are deed as principles of transaction-oriented database recovery.
For instance, the system may have no room left on its disk drives, or it may have used up its allocated CPU time.
It consists of two operations, withdrawing the money from A and saving it to B. Two phase dods is often applied to guarantee full isolation. Meaning, the operation to deduct funds from checking cannot complete unless the operation to deposit into savings succeeds.
What does acid mean in database systems?
Use our Power Search technology to look for more unique definitions from across the web! The database eliminates T1's effects, and T2 sees only valid data. Atomicity, Consistency, Isolation, Find a date in Spencerville Maryland. Meaning of ACID. What does ACID mean? If you clicked first, you will get the six items you want, and they will only get four. Maybe you were acir for one of these abbreviations: Discuss these ACID abbreviations with the community: 0 Comments Notify me of new comments via .